The Global Natural Fiber Reinforced Composites (NFRC) Market was valued at USD 273.5 Million in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 397.6 Million by 2030,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.4% during the forecast period (2024–2030). This robust growth is fueled by escalating demand for lightweight, sustainable materials across the automotive, construction, and aerospace sectors, coupled with stringent government regulations aimed at reducing carbon footprints.
As industries worldwide pivot towards eco-friendly and circular economy models, Natural Fiber Reinforced Composites are emerging as a viable alternative to conventional glass and carbon fiber composites. 🔟 1. UPM Biocomposites
Headquarters: Helsinki, Finland
Key Offering: UPM Formi, UPM ProFi biocomposite materials
UPM Biocomposites is a global leader in developing and manufacturing advanced biocomposites. Their flagship products, UPM Formi and UPM ProFi, are made from cellulose fibers and bio-based polymers, offering excellent mechanical properties and a significantly reduced environmental impact compared to traditional composites.

9️⃣ 2. Weyerhaeuser Company
Headquarters: Seattle, Washington, USA
Key Offering: Engineered wood products, cellulose fibers for composites
Weyerhaeuser, one of the world’s largest private owners of timberlands, is a key supplier of wood-derived fibers for the NFRC market. The company provides high-quality cellulose fibers that serve as reinforcement in thermoplastic and thermoset composites for various industrial applications.

8️⃣ 3. Procotex SA
Headquarters: Kortrijk, Belgium
Key Offering: Flax, hemp, and jute fiber reinforcements
Procotex specializes in the production and supply of high-quality natural fibers, including flax, hemp, and jute, for the composite industry. The company offers a range of fiber formats, such as non-wovens, rovings, and mats, tailored for automotive, sports, and consumer goods applications.

7️⃣ 4. Trex Company, Inc.
Headquarters: Winchester, Virginia, USA
Key Offering: Trex® composite decking, railing, and outdoor living products
Trex is the world’s largest manufacturer of wood-alternative decking and railing, a leader in recycling and composite manufacturing. Their products are made from a blend of reclaimed wood and plastic film, offering durability and low maintenance while diverting millions of pounds of waste from landfills annually.

6️⃣ 5. Tecnaro GmbH
Headquarters: Ilsfeld, Germany
Key Offering: ARBOBLEND®, ARBOFORM® (liquid wood) bioplastics
Tecnaro is a pioneer in developing and producing thermoplastic materials made from renewable resources. Their ARBOBLEND and ARBOFORM materials are innovative biocomposites that combine natural fibers like wood, flax, or hemp with biopolymers, offering properties comparable to conventional engineering plastics.

5️⃣ 6. Flexform Technologies
Headquarters: Elkhart, Indiana, USA
Key Offering: Lightweight natural fiber composite substrates
Flexform Technologies specializes in manufacturing ultra-lightweight, high-strength composite panels using natural fibers like flax, hemp, and kenaf. Their patented compression molding process is used by major automotive OEMs to produce interior components that are lighter, stronger, and more sustainable.

4️⃣ 7. Greencore Composites Inc.
Headquarters: Plainfield, Illinois, USA
Key Offering: Custom molded natural fiber composites
Greencore Composites is a manufacturer of custom compression-molded parts using natural fibers. Serving the automotive, furniture, and industrial markets, the company focuses on creating durable, lightweight components that meet rigorous performance standards while utilizing renewable materials.

2️⃣ 9. Jelu-Werk Josef Ehrler GmbH & Co. KG
Headquarters: Rosenberg, Germany
Key Offering: JELUCOMP® natural fiber reinforced thermoplastics
Jelu-Werk is a specialist in compounding natural fibers like wood, flax, and hemp with thermoplastics to create JELUCOMP materials. These compounds are used in automotive interiors, consumer goods, and building products, providing a natural look and feel along with technical performance.

🌍 Outlook: The Future of Composites Is Natural and Circular
The Natural Fiber Reinforced Composites market is undergoing a significant transformation. While synthetic composites still dominate in high-performance applications, the industry is rapidly embracing natural fibers due to their environmental benefits, cost-effectiveness, and improving technical capabilities.
📈 Key Trends Shaping the Market:
-
Accelerated adoption in the automotive industry for interior trim, door panels, and trunk liners to meet lightweighting and sustainability targets.
-
Growing demand in the construction sector for decking, fencing, and architectural elements driven by green building certifications.
-
Advancements in fiber treatment and coupling agents that enhance the interfacial adhesion between natural fibers and polymer matrices.
-
Increasing R&D investment in hybrid composites that combine natural fibers with other reinforcements for specialized applications.
